Making Conscious Choices: From Floorboards to Framework
When it pertains to selecting products, the range of eco-conscious selections has never ever been much more bountiful. Recovered timber, for example, supplies a warm, rustic beauty while giving new life to previously utilized materials. Bamboo is one more preferred choice for flooring-- fast-growing and extremely eco-friendly, it brings a modern appearance with a considerably reduced ecological cost. For insulation, natural alternatives like lamb's wool or cellulose supply excellent thermal security without unsafe chemicals. Even paints and adhesives now are available in low-VOC or zero-VOC formulas, lowering harmful discharges inside the home.

Bringing the Outdoors In with Sustainable Decking Options
Exterior spaces are equally as important when taking into consideration an eco-friendly method. Decks, patio areas, and yards all supply opportunities to combine convenience with preservation. Typical outdoor decking products, such as without treatment timber, may come with high maintenance needs and much shorter life-spans. The good news is, there are far better options today. Composite decking, made from a mix of recycled timber and plastics, has gained appeal for its lasting longevity and minimized environmental impact. It resembles the appearance of wood without the demand for rough sealants or regular repair work.

Small Changes, Big Results: Everyday Sustainability at Home
Even if you're not handling a full-blown restoration, little updates can still make a huge difference. Swapping out old light bulbs for LEDs, installing a smart hot water heater, or changing single-pane home windows with protected ones can substantially minimize a home's power use. Sustainable living does not need to be frustrating-- it's typically the build-up of thoughtful choices that leads to lasting adjustment.
And it's not nearly the preliminary setup. Maintenance plays a significant function in extending the life of your home and the products you've selected. Sealing splits, checking water use, and maintaining HVAC systems tidy are ongoing behaviors that protect efficiency and shield your financial investment.
